The Rise of Interactive Blockchain-Based Gaming: A Case Study in U.K. Preference

Over the past decade, the gaming industry has undergone a transformative shift, driven by technological innovation and changing consumer behaviours. Among the most significant developments is the emergence of blockchain technology within the gaming ecosystem, offering new paradigms for ownership, engagement, and monetisation. This evolution is particularly evident in the United Kingdom, where the gaming community demonstrates a keen appetite for innovative, decentralised experiences that challenge traditional models.

Blockchain and the Modern Gaming Landscape: An Industry Overview

Blockchain’s integration into gaming facilitates a level of transparency and player agency unprecedented in conventional titles. Non-fungible tokens (NFTs), in-game asset ownership, and decentralised economies are now becoming standard features, enabling players to truly own their digital assets and trade them securely. According to a 2023 report by Newzoo, the global blockchain gaming market is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of over 40% through 2027, with Europe — particularly the U.K. — emerging as a key hub for innovative projects.

Major industry players and startups alike are investing heavily in blockchain-enabled titles, which are often characterised by their play-to-earn mechanics, transparent marketplaces, and player-centric governance structures. These features address core issues related to asset ownership rights and fairness, setting a new standard within digital entertainment.

The British Gaming Audience: Embracing Innovation with Caution

The U.K. boasts a vibrant gaming culture, underpinned by a robust demographic spanning casual gamers, esports competitors, and crypto-enthusiasts. Recent surveys indicate that nearly 35% of UK gamers have engaged with blockchain-based gaming platforms, reflecting both curiosity and trust in the technology’s potential.

“British players are increasingly seeking experiences that meld entertainment with economic empowerment – blockchain-based games meet this need by offering real ownership and secure trading,” notes industry analyst Claire Evans.

Integrating Blockchain with Regulatory and Ethical Considerations

As the industry accelerates, regulators and developers face complex challenges surrounding data security, financial compliance, and responsible gaming. While blockchain offers transparency and a tamper-proof infrastructure, concerns about gambling-related elements and the exchange of real money need careful navigation. The U.K. Gambling Commission has begun scrutinising blockchain gaming projects to establish frameworks that protect consumers while encouraging innovation.
